California Hachiya Persimmons Organic (5 lbs) are premium, large acorn-shaped persimmons grown organically in the Sacramento Valley. Known for their astringent taste until fully soft and dark orange, they transform into a sweet, pudding-like delight packed with Vitamin C and antioxidants. Ideal for fresh consumption or traditional dried persimmon recipes, these persimmons arrive carefully packaged to preserve freshness and quality.
